Design

Design is a crucial aspect of abstract coloring pages flowers, characterized by simplified and stylized forms that capture the essence of flowers. These forms deviate from realistic depictions, embracing abstraction to convey emotions, ideas, and personal interpretations.

  • Minimalist Lines: Abstract coloring pages flowers often use simple lines to outline the basic structure and shape of flowers, reducing them to their most essential forms.
  • Geometric Patterns: Geometric shapes like circles, triangles, and squares may be incorporated into the design, creating a sense of order and balance while adding visual interest.
  • Exaggerated Features: Certain elements of the flower, such as petals or stems, may be exaggerated or distorted to emphasize specific characteristics or create a unique aesthetic.
  • Symbolic Representation: Abstract coloring pages flowers can use symbolic or metaphorical forms to convey emotions or ideas associated with flowers, such as love, hope, or growth.

These design elements contribute to the distinct visual appeal and expressive nature of abstract coloring pages flowers. They allow artists and colorists to explore their creativity, emotions, and interpretations of the natural world through a simplified and stylized lens.

Tips for Mastering Abstract Coloring Pages Flowers

This section provides valuable tips to help you unlock your creativity and elevate your experience with abstract coloring pages flowers.

Tip 1: Embrace Experimentation: Let go of perfectionism and allow your imagination to guide you. Try unusual color combinations, explore different techniques, and don’t be afraid to make mistakes.

Tip 2: Focus on the Process: Don’t rush through the coloring process. Take your time, observe the interplay of colors and shapes, and let the activity become a meditative and mindful experience.

Tip 3: Explore Color Theory: Experiment with warm and cool colors, complementary colors, and analogous color schemes to create visually striking and harmonious compositions.

Tip 4: Utilize Negative Space: Pay attention to the areas around and between the flowers. Use negative space effectively to create a sense of depth and balance in your artwork.

Tip 5: Layer and Blend Colors: Layer different colors and blend them seamlessly to achieve depth and richness. Use a variety of blending techniques, such as overlapping, wet-on-wet, and dry brushing.

Tip 6: Add Details and Textures: Enhance your flowers with intricate details, such as dots, lines, and patterns. Experiment with different textures to create a sense of depth and visual interest.

Tip 7: Seek Inspiration: Draw inspiration from nature, other art forms, or your own emotions. Let your surroundings and experiences influence your color choices and design decisions.
